Thermal paper, commonly used in point-of-sale systems, provides a cost-effective and efficient method for generating immediate transaction records. This heat-sensitive medium facilitates the printing of receipts without ink or ribbons, making it ideal for fast-paced retail environments. A typical example includes the itemized lists of purchases provided to customers upon checkout.

The convenience and reliability of this technology contribute significantly to smooth business operations. Its ability to produce durable, legible records enables accurate accounting, efficient inventory management, and facilitates returns or exchanges. Historically, this method replaced manual carbon copy systems, marking a substantial advancement in transaction processing. Its development has played a pivotal role in the evolution of modern retail and financial transactions.

A device designed for automated folding creates a specific fold pattern known as a tri-fold, where a sheet is folded twice to create three panels. This folding style is commonly used for brochures, leaflets, and letters, offering a compact and presentable format for information distribution.

Automated folding offers significant advantages over manual folding, particularly for large volumes. It provides increased speed and precision, ensuring consistent folds and a professional finish. This efficiency reduces labor costs and processing time, contributing to smoother workflow and higher productivity. The history of automated folding is tied to the rise of office automation and the need for efficient document handling, evolving alongside printing and mailing technologies.

High-volume, automated devices designed for destroying sensitive documents and media in bulk are essential for businesses and organizations. These devices typically handle large quantities of paper, cardboard, and other materials, reducing them to small, unreadable particles or shreds. For example, a large corporation might utilize such a device to dispose of confidential client information or outdated financial records.

Secure disposal of sensitive information is paramount in today’s world. These high-capacity devices offer a crucial layer of protection against data breaches and identity theft, contributing significantly to compliance with data protection regulations. Historically, manual shredding was the norm, a time-consuming and less secure process. The development of automated, high-throughput shredding technologies has revolutionized information security management, enabling organizations to efficiently and effectively protect sensitive data.

Heavy-duty automated devices designed for precise, high-volume sheet material processing transform raw paper rolls or stacks into specific sizes and shapes. These devices are categorized by various factors, including cutting method (guillotine, rotary, die), material capacity, and level of automation, ranging from smaller, semi-automatic cutters for modest print shops to large, fully automated systems for high-output packaging facilities. For instance, a rotary cutter might be employed for labels, while a guillotine cutter handles large stacks of paper for brochures.

Streamlined cutting processes are essential for numerous industries. The ability to efficiently and accurately process large quantities of paper or card stock significantly impacts productivity and profitability in printing, packaging, and converting operations. This technology evolved from manual cutting methods, significantly increasing production speed and accuracy, minimizing waste, and improving workplace safety. Historically, hand-operated cutters posed risks and limited production volumes. The automation and precision offered by these advanced systems are now crucial for meeting modern demands.

These rolls of paper, specifically designed for use in adding machines and calculators, are typically long and narrow, with a smooth surface for clear printing. They often feature pre-printed lines or grids to facilitate neat calculations and record-keeping. A common example is the two-ply roll, which creates a duplicate record of each transaction.

Essential for maintaining accurate financial records, these supplies provide a tangible audit trail for businesses, accountants, and individuals. Their use predates digital calculators and spreadsheets, offering a reliable method for tracking calculations and ensuring data integrity. This historical significance underscores their enduring value in specific applications where physical records are preferred or required.

Automated devices utilizing electric power to precisely and efficiently cut paper stock are vital tools in various industries. These devices range from small, personal crafting tools suitable for intricate designs to large, industrial-grade equipment capable of handling bulk material and high-volume output. A typical example is a device used for creating precisely cut business cards or detailed scrapbooking embellishments.

The advent of these automated cutting tools significantly improved productivity and precision compared to manual methods. They offer enhanced speed, consistency, and the ability to execute complex cuts that would be challenging or impossible by hand. This evolution from hand-operated paper cutters represents a major advancement in paper handling technology, benefiting industries from printing and packaging to crafts and manufacturing. Their ability to automate repetitive tasks frees up human resources for more complex work, while minimizing material waste through accurate cutting.

Determining the mass per unit area of paper stock is essential for various applications. This measurement, typically expressed in grams per square meter (gsm) or pounds per ream, provides crucial information for printers, designers, and paper manufacturers. For instance, a thicker cardstock might be 250 gsm, while standard printer paper often falls around 80 gsm. Understanding this metric allows for accurate material selection based on project needs.

This standardized measurement ensures consistency and predictability in printing and packaging. It allows professionals to estimate project costs, anticipate postage expenses, and select appropriate printing equipment. Historically, variations in paper density led to inconsistencies in printing outcomes. The adoption of standardized weight measurements revolutionized the industry, enabling greater precision and efficiency.

A tool for determining the mass per unit volume of paper is essential in various industries. This involves inputting the paper’s mass and dimensions (length, width, and thickness or caliper) into a formula or online tool, outputting a value typically expressed in grams per cubic centimeter (g/cm) or pounds per cubic foot (lb/ft). For example, if a sheet weighs 10 grams and occupies a volume of 2 cubic centimeters, its density is 5 g/cm.

Understanding this property is crucial for print production, packaging design, and paper manufacturing. It affects printing press performance, ink absorption, and the overall feel and durability of the final product. Historically, paper density has been a key factor in determining paper quality and suitability for different applications, from lightweight airmail paper to thick cardstock. Optimizing this characteristic can lead to cost savings through reduced material usage and improved product performance.
